K80E (p.Lys80Glu) variant of SPTB (Spectrin beta chain, erythrocytic)
K80E (p.Lys80Glu) in SPTB (Spectrin beta chain, erythrocytic)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of not provided; Inborn genetic diseases.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.53 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data and published literature.
